Abstract:
Familial Mediterranean fever (FMF) is a hereditary autosomal recessive ,systemic, auto-inflammatory disorder characterized by sporadic, unpredictable attacks of fever and serosal inflammation. FMF is caused by mutations in MEFV, a gene located on the short arm of chromosome 16 (16p13) which encodes a protein 'Pyrin'. The disorder has been given various names including familial paroxysmal polyserositis, periodic peritonitis, recurrent polyserositis, benign paroxysmal peritonitis, and periodic disease or periodic fever, As the name indicates, FMF occurs within families and is much more common in individuals of Mediterranean descent than in persons of any other ethnicity. It has been described in several ethnic groups including Sephardic Jews, Armenians, Turks, North Africans, Arabs, Greeks, and Italians. However, the disease is not restricted to these groups and sporadic cases have been reported. Diagnosis is usually clinical and it classically presents with unprovoked, recurrent attacks of fever and painful polyserositis mainly affecting the peritoneum (most common), synovium, and pleura that usually (but not always) begin in childhood. We present a atypical case of FMF with type 1 Diabetes Mellitus and FMF who had no fever, Mediterranean ancestory or family history and discuss his clinical features,diagnosis and management.

Background:
- Familial Mediterranean fever (FMF) is a hereditary systemic auto-inflammatory disorder.
- It is caused by mutations in the MEFV gene, encoding the Pyrin protein.
- Classic FMF presents with recurrent fever and polyserositis, typically in childhood.
Observation:
- This report details an atypical FMF case.
- The patient presented with type 1 Diabetes Mellitus and FMF.
- Notably, the patient lacked fever, Mediterranean ancestry, and a family history of FMF.
